s Ireland’Budget 2025, presented by Finance Minister Jack Chambers (33) on 1 October. Key components included tax cuts, social welfare increases, and significant investments in housing and businesses, all aimed at supporting individuals and stimulating economic growth. The budget delivers on income tax changes by increasing the threshold for the higher 40% rate by €2,000 to €44,000 and cutting the Universal Social Charge (USC) from 4% to 3%.
